Things You Will Need:
Eggs
Vanilla
Cinnamon
2% milk
Bacon
Butter
Syrup
Griddle pan
Cinnamon French toast (Macy’s bakery: Arcade)
Step 1:
Mix the vanilla, eggs, cinnamon, and milk into a bowl and stir it well.
Extra vanilla and cinnamon goes a long way.
* We never measure this, but I’m sure you’ve made French toast before and can gauge it.
Step 2:
Lay out the bacon and cook on 375
to your your liking.
Step 3:
Slice your bead into 3/4″ pieces. Dip them in the cinnamon egg mixture, and transfer them to your griddle pan.
Cook to your liking.
